Manninen, 30, spent the 2021-22 season in the KHL with Salavat Yulayev Ufa, where he had 32 points (nineteen goals, thirteen assists), twelve penalty minutes and was a plus-three in 38 games. In March, he left the team due to Russia's invasion of Ukraine.
The Oulu native had a big year on the international stage with Finland. He had seven points in six games at the 2022 Winter Olympics in China, helping Finland win their first-ever Olympic gold medal. Then, three months later he helped Finland win the 2022 World Hockey Championship, scoring the golden goal in overtime against Canada.
